DIRAK-SNAP-Technology promoted as a simple, secure alternative approach to installation of panel hardware

1 min read

Customer feedback to FDB Panel Fittings and sales partner DIRAK indicated that customers of furniture, lighting, electrical housings, electronics, and building fixtures and fittings were tired of wasting time dealing with screws, washers, back-nuts and other loose parts.

It seemed that assemblers and installers would welcome a simple click-fit and comprehensive program of enclosure/cabinet hardware, without all the fiddling about.

By connecting ideas in a new way, the engineering team developed a pioneering technology which it called DIRAK-SNAP-Technology (DST). The resulting system is said to offer easily-made high-strength panel connections without the use of any tools – so that specialist panel builders can create the perfect solution, simply and securely in seconds. It is a system which offers precise, quick installation with reduced assembly time and high-retention, safe, vibration-proof service, according to the supplier.

It adds that DIRAK-SNAP-Technology greatly reduces the risk of assembly errors, such as improper torque specs. An audible click confirms proper assembly, which is helpful especially in applications which are hard to access. Removal is with either standard or DIRAK-specific tools.

The design concept is based on the same principle as a slam-latch, similar to those used in a door.It is made up of two wedges with ramped edges, and a spring set into a window within the wedges. These components are then inserted into the hardware and secured with a plastic plug to keep them in place. As the DST component is pressed into the sheet metal cut-out, the ramps on the wedges allow them to retract against the spring. When the ramps pass their apex, the spring pressure spreads them back outwards, resulting in the distinctive ‘snap’ sound. The component is thereby secured into the sheet metal, resulting in a secure, high-strength connection which naturally tightens.

The DST series includes captive fasteners for light-weight sheet materials as well as for heavier gauge materials and heavier duty applications, for example enclosures and cabinets. Conceived as a complete system, components include: cam catch, clamping handle, clamping latch, compression latch, quarter turn locks, swinghandles, concealed hinges, removable pin hinges, external hinges for surface mounted doors, lift off hinges, adjustable hinge, bridge and bow handles, finger pull handles, slam latch, recessed pull handle, tubular handle, stainless steel hinges.

Many DST products are tested according to DIN EN 61373 for vibration and shock and GR-63-CORE, Issue 4 for earthquakes.

Reinforcement plates are available to increase strength and load capacity.

Where electrical continuity is required then safe and reliable electrical grounding is achieved with easily-fitted grounding clips. Where additional security is required then components requiring specialized DIRAK tools are available to address cases where vandalism or theft are concerns.
